=Fool’s Parsley= (_Aethusa Cynapium_, L.). Much has been written about
the toxic properties of this weed of cultivated fields, principally
because, owing to the fact that the foliage has often been mistaken or
misused for parsley and the roots for radishes (!), it has been the
cause of human poisoning, though it seems to be one of the least active
of the poisonous Umbellifers. Its poisonous character is undoubted, but
it is unlikely to cause the poisoning of stock, which seem to refuse it.
Some authors regard it as strongly poisonous, but others as more or less
harmless. Johnson and Sowerby cite a case in which a child of five years
old died within an hour after eating the root, and a second death (in
Germany) within twenty-four hours from the use of the leaves in soup.
The most complete account of this plant is that by Power and Tutin,
issued from the Wellcome Chemical Research Laboratories in 1905. Many
authors since 1807 are cited as writing of its poisonous properties, and
of cases of poisoning, two of which terminated fatally. Miller (1807)
says that “most cattle eat it, but it is said to be noxious to geese.”
Bentley and Trimen write that “in all recorded experiments with it on
animals, it has had poisonous effects.” Dr. John Harley (1876 and 1880),
after experiments on a child and adults, concluded that the plant was
absolutely free from the noxious properties attributed to it. In 1904,
however, a case of severe poisoning by it was recorded (_Brit. Med.
Jour._, July 16, 1904, p. 124).
_Toxic Principle._ This has for many years been stated to be the
alkaloid _Cynapine_. For their investigation Messrs. Power and Tutin
collected the plant round London in July and August, with the fruits
still green, and after thorough chemical examination found 0·015 per
cent. of an _essential oil_ of rather unpleasant odour; 0·8 per cent. of
_resinous substances_; and an exceedingly small amount of a _volatile
alkaloid_ having the peculiar characteristic odour of _Coniine_. The
amount of hydrochloride of the alkaloid obtained showed that if the base
were Coniine it would correspond to only 0·00023 per cent. of Coniine in
the plant. In a degree this confirms the statement by Walz (1859) that
the fruit “contains a volatile base, very similar in odour and chemical
behaviour to Coniine, and probably identical with it.” The investigators
suggest that the alkaloid is Coniine, and the small amount would justify
the opinion, but there may be variation in toxic property according to
stage of development and climate. The authors conclude that “it cannot
be considered improbable that under favourable conditions of growth, the
proportion of alkaloid may be increased to such an extent as to impart
to the plant the poisonous properties ascribed to it.”
